You can use Grab to get more Blocks, since Mummies don't have Block, there is a good chance you just push your opponent around a lot. Use Grab to feed the player to a Zombie.

by mage75
On my undead team I had both a break tackle and a stand firm mummy. For me the break tackle was waaaay more useful. Once you use it early in a game, your opponent starts to realise that feeding your mummy a lineman just isn't good enough to stop you hurting them. All of a sudden they need to keep an additional man in between you and the cage to stop you smashing through.

That said, I tend to GFI a lot with my mummies, as people tend to think that 4 squares away is plenty of room. As far as I am concerned with armour 9 I am happy to fall over from time to time! It's worth it to get my guard mummy in base contact with the ball carrier.
